Gather Your Ingredients:

  • 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 3/4 cups granulated sugar
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ips (optional)

Prepare Your Pampered Chef Pan:

  1. Generously grease a 9x13-inch Pampered Chef pan with cooking spray or butter.
  2.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).

Make the Brownie Batter:

  1. In a large m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
  2.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  3. In a separate bowl, combine the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t.
  4.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  5. Fold in the chocolate chips, if desired.

Pour the Batter and Bake:

  1. Pour the brownie batter into the prepared Pampered Chef pan, spreading it evenly.
  2. Place the pan in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with just a few moist crumbs attached.

Batter in Pampered Chef Pan

Let the Brownies Cool:

  1. Remove the pan from the oven and place it on a wire rack to cool completely.
  2. Once cooled, cut the brownies into squares and enjoy!

Tips for Perfect Brownies:

  • For fudgier brownies, reduce the baking time by 5 minutes.
  • For cakier brownies, increase the baking time by 5 minutes.
  • To add a crispy crust, sprinkle a layer of chopped nuts or toffee bits on top of the batter before baking.
  • For a decadent treat, top the brownies with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or whipped cream.

Variations on the Classic Brownie Recipe:

  • Walnut Brownies: Add 1 cup of chopped walnuts to the batter for a crunchy twist.
  • Peppermint Brownies: Add 1/2 teaspoon of peppermint extract and a handful of crushed candy canes to the batter.
  • Peanut Butter Swirl Brownies: Swirl 1/2 cup of peanut butter into the brownie batter before baking.
  • Salted Caramel Brownies: Drizzle salted caramel sauce over the brownies before serving.

Caramel Brownies

  • Pumpkin Brownies: Substitute 1 cup of mashed pumpkin for 1 cup of flour in the batter.

Storing and Freezing Brownies:

  • Storing: Store leftover br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, or in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
  • Freezing: Freeze brownies in an airtight container for up to 2 months. Thaw them overnight in the refrigerator before serving.
